Job Summary
Position Summary
Produces quality ultrasound examinations which are used in medical diagnosis and interpreted by Radiologists/MD and may include abdominal, pelvic, OB/GYN, small parts and interventional ultrasound procedures.
Responsibilities- Performs billing and charging with computer systems.
- Follows proper protocol and associated paperwork for servicing malfunctioning equipment.
- Inputs charges in computer system. Obtains patient history for each examination from patient and/or chart.
- Documents examination information completely and accurately to appropriate medical personnel by using examination worksheets, written preliminary reports when needed and/or verbal notification.
- Utilizes periodic QC and preventative maintenance and proficiency in proper patient positioning to achieve best examination results. Explains the ultrasound process to each patient prior to the examination.
- Verifies proper patient identification using patient armband.
- Uses equipment (phones, faxes, copiers, information systems). Ensures proper protocol for filing and copying ultrasound examinations.
- Other related job tasks or responsibilities as assigned.
- Special
Skills:- Excellent verbal and written communication skills necessary to understand oral and written instructions stated in radiological and medical terms and to exchange information with patients and staff.
- Proficient with general operating procedures, e.g. start up procedures, calibration of equipment, troubleshooting and problem solving.
